网络安全在当今数字化时代变得越来越重要,Linux 作为一种可靠、稳定且广泛使用的操作系统,在网络安全监控和防护方面具有很大的潜力。本文将介绍如何在 Linux 系统中进行网络安全监控与防护,并提供一些有用的工具和技巧。
1. 了解网络威胁
在开始网络安全监控和防护之前,了解不同类型的网络威胁是至关重要的。包括但不限于流量分析、端口扫描、恶意软件和入侵等。这样可以更好地了解潜在的安全隐患,并采取相应的预防措施。
2. 使用防火墙
防火墙是 Linux 系统中最基本的网络安全措施之一。它可以设置一些规则,过滤流经系统的网络数据包,并对其进行检查。使用 Linux 系统内置的防火墙工具,如 iptables
或 ufw
,可以轻松地设置和管理防火墙规则。
3. 实施入侵检测系统(IDS)
入侵检测系统(Intrusion Detection System,简称 IDS)可以帮助识别和响应潜在的网络入侵。Linux 下有几个流行的 IDS 工具,如 Snort
、Bro
和 Suricata
。这些工具可以分析网络数据包、监视网络流量并发出警报。设置 IDS 可以大大增强网络的安全性。
4. 设置网络监控工具
Linux 环境下有很多强大的网络监控工具可用于监测网络流量、连接状态和活动日志。其中一种常见的工具是 nethogs
,它可以显示当前系统上正在使用网络的进程和带宽使用情况。另一个有用的工具是 tcpdump
,它可以捕获和分析网络数据包。
5. 使用加密协议和 VPN
为了保护敏感数据的传输安全,使用加密协议和虚拟私人网络(VPN)是必不可少的。例如,使用 HTTPS 替代 HTTP,以确保在网页浏览过程中的数据加密。而 VPN 则可以在公共网络上建立一个安全的连接通道,确保数据传输是加密和安全的。
6. 更新和维护系统
及时地更新和维护 Linux 系统也是保持网络安全的重要部分。定期获取安全补丁和更新可以修复已知的漏洞和问题,从而减少系统受到攻击的风险。使用系统提供的自动更新功能可以帮助您保持系统的安全和稳定。
结语
网络安全是一个动态的领域,需要我们不断学习和适应新的技术和挑战。在 Linux 系统中进行网络安全监控和防护需要一些专业的知识和技巧,但通过采取合适的措施,我们可以保护我们的系统和数据免受潜在的网络威胁。希望本文能为您提供一些有用的信息和指导。
注:本文所涉及的所有命令和工具都可以使用 Linux 系统的包管理器进行安装,并按照其官方文档进行详细配置和使用。
本文来自极简博客,作者:时光旅者,转载请注明原文链接:在Linux系统中进行网络安全监控与防护